Calibration, measurement and test laboratories should provide reliable, accurate and timely service in accordance with the technological conditions of the day. The ability of laboratories to provide such a service is explained in detail in the ISO/IEC 17025:2017 “General Requirements for the Competence of Experiment and Calibration Laboratories” standard. There are some unclear situations in the application of the ISO/IEC 17025 standard in laboratories serving in the medical field, in other words, performing calibration, measurement and testing of devices in hospitals. Most of the medical devices are multi-parameter measuring devices. Therefore, the calibrators, analyzers or simulators used in the measurements and testing of these devices are generally multifunctional devices. In this article, the most common problems in the technical accreditation audits of medical laboratories will be examined and solution suggestions will be presented.
